Assessment and Planning
We start by looking at the full scope of the problem. How much water is there? What areas are affected? We check for hidden damage and potential risks. This step is key. It helps us create a plan that works for your home. We don’t rush into anything. We take the time to make sure we understand exactly what needs to be done. Accurate assessment means better results. Clear communication gives you peace of mind. Proper planning prevents future issues.
Water Removal
We use powerful extractors to remove standing water. This step is fast, but it’s not just about speed. We have to be careful with the structure of your home. We work to get as much water out as possible. We also check for moisture in walls and floors. This helps us know where to focus next. Efficient extraction reduces the risk of mold. Thorough inspection ensures nothing is missed. Quick action is the best way to avoid bigger problems.
Moisture Removal
After the water is gone, we focus on drying. We bring in industrial dehumidifiers and air movers. These tools work to pull out any remaining moisture. We check progress regularly. This step can take a few days. It’s important to be patient. We don’t want to rush and risk hidden damage. Proper drying prevents mold. Continuous monitoring keeps things on track. Expert techniques ensure a complete job.
Sanitization
Sewage water is dangerous. We use EPA-approved disinfectants to clean and sanitize all affected areas. We treat surfaces, carpets, and even air ducts. This step is crucial for your health. We make sure everything is safe before we leave. Safe environment is our goal. Thorough cleaning removes all traces of contamination. Health-focused approach is what we do best.

|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, location, and type of surfaces affected.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$750 – $4,000 | Size of area, moisture level, and how long it takes to dry. |
| Sanitization | $300 – $1,500 | Extent of contamination and surfaces needing treatment. |
| Structural rep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Damage to walls, floors, or furniture. |
| Odor removal | $200 – $1,200 | Severity of smell and how long it’s been present. |
| Final inspection and documentation | $100 – $600 | Complexity of the job and any insurance paperwork needed. |
